Definition for Grant (-ed)

grant (-ed), v. [L. 'entrust'.]

  1. Allow; permit; make it possible.
  2. Give; afford; spare; bestow on; provide without expecting compensation.
  3. Yield; furnish; render to; concede to.
  4. Phrase. “Grant God”: I pray; may it be His will that.
